The Real Reason Taylor Swift's 'Tortured Poets' Is Dividing The Fandom
Briefly

Arguably more than with any of her other works, fans like me are diving deep into Swift's new double album, uncovering narrative threads (or rather, invisible strings) to her previous work, expanding the 'lore' of her entire catalog, and unifying her most devoted fans.
Tortured Poets is splitting the fandom into OG hardcore Swifties, who are more invested in her lyrics and intentions behind the songs, and casual fans, who became fans through pop hits like 'Cruel Summer' and the Eras Tour.
Fans' discoveries - such as speculation that The Anthology track 'Peter' may have been written from the perspective of the little girl in Swift's Folklore track 'Seven' - are bringing a renewed sense of community among those who are enjoying the album.
Those detective-level abilities are a byproduct of Swift herself, who has intentionally left Easter eggs throughout her career, from secret messages in her album booklets to hidden clues about her upcoming projects.
